The Seahawks are back home in Week 3 to host the New Orleans Saints following an impressive double-digit road win in Pittsburgh last weekend. The Saints, meanwhile, have opened the season 0-2 under first-year head coach Kellen Moore, but have been competitive in both games, a pair of one-score losses.
Here are five things to watch as the Seahawks look for their first home win of the season:
1. Can the Seahawks start fast again and ride that momentum to a needed home victory?
The Seahawks started last week's game with the ball, then promptly drove the length of the field, capping the drive with a Sam Darnold touchdown pass to rookie Tory Horton.
